Types of Jobs in Bahrain for Kenyans

Bahrain offers a diverse range of job opportunities for Kenyans, across various industries, including finance, healthcare, education, IT, and hospitality. Some of the most in-demand jobs in Bahrain for Kenyans include:

  • Finance professionals: With several major banks and financial institutions operating in Bahrain, finance professionals skilled in areas like accounting, auditing, and financial analysis are in high demand.
  • Medical professionals: Bahrain’s healthcare sector is growing rapidly, and medical professionals, including doctors, nurses, and pharmacists, are needed to fill various roles.
  • Teachers: With a high demand for quality education, teachers qualified to teach subjects like mathematics, science, and languages are sought after by Bahrain’s schools and universities.
  • IT professionals: As Bahrain continues to invest in its digital infrastructure, IT professionals with expertise in areas like software development, data analytics, and cybersecurity are in high demand.
  • Hotel and hospitality staff: Bahrain’s tourism industry is thriving, and hospitality professionals, including hotel managers, chefs, and customer service staff, are needed to cater to the growing number of tourists.

Benefits of Working in Bahrain for Kenyans

Working in Bahrain offers a range of benefits for Kenyans, including:

  • High standard of living: Bahrain offers a high standard of living, with access to modern amenities, excellent education and healthcare systems, and a relatively low cost of living.
  • Tax-free salaries: Bahrain offers tax-free salaries to expats, making it an attractive option for professionals seeking to maximize their earnings.
  • Cultural immersion: Bahrain offers a unique cultural experience, with a blend of traditional and modern influences, and a diverse expat community.
  • Opportunities for career advancement: Bahrain’s growing economy and business sector offer opportunities for career advancement and professional growth.

Q: What are the requirements for a Kenyan to work in Bahrain?

A Kenyan can work in Bahrain with a valid employment visa, obtained after applying for a job with a Bahraini employer. The employer must sponsor the employment visa application and obtain a work permit from the Ministry of Labor in Bahrain. The Kenyan must also undergo a medical examination and obtain a health certificate.

Q: What types of jobs are available for Kenyans in Bahrain?

Bahrain offers various job opportunities for Kenyans, including teaching, nursing, engineering, IT, hospitality, and management positions. Many international companies, government agencies, and private organizations in Bahrain hire expatriates, including Kenyans. Job seekers can search for job openings on online platforms, company websites, and through recruitment agencies.

Q: Can a Kenyan apply for a job in Bahrain without a sponsor?

No, a Kenyan cannot apply for a job in Bahrain without a sponsor. Bahraini law requires employers to sponsor the employment visa application for foreign workers. However, some recruitment agencies in Bahrain may offer sponsorship to qualified candidates. It’s essential to research and work with reputable recruitment agencies.
